WisBusiness: the Podcast with Tricia Braun, Wisconsin Data Center Coalition
This week’s episode of “WisBusiness: the Podcast” is with Tricia Braun, executive director of the Wisconsin Data Center Coalition.
The podcast explores the evolving conversation and controversies around data centers in the state, featuring highlights on some of the most high-profile projects and their impacts as well as how public opinion has shifted over time.
Wisconsin has seen multiple communities move forward with data center moratoriums amid a public backlash against data centers. Concerns range from environmental impacts and noise to the potential for higher energy costs linked to the projects.
The latest Marquette University Law School poll of registered voters found views on data center costs versus benefits have darkened substantially from last year, with just 22% of those in the latest survey saying benefits outweigh costs. Late last year, that percentage was 44%.
